WebTesticular failure and low testosterone level may be hard to diagnose in older men because testosterone level normally decreases slowly with age. Testicular failure and low testosterone level also may be hard to diagnose in obese men. This is because obesity lowers a carrier molecule for testosterone called SHBG.
